Noise

Washing machines can generate quite a lot of sound particularly during the spin cycle. This can be caused by unbalanced loads, the vibrations of the machine, or by a noisy motor. The most frequent reason for noise is a damaged drum. Coins and other debris can get stuck in the drum's interior which can cause a lot noise during the washing cycle. These items are more frequent than people realise and it is important to check your washer regularly to make sure there's no debris trapped inside.

Other causes of excessive sound could be the wrong temperature of the water or a dirty air filter, or problems in the bearings on the rear drum. Bearings ensure that the inner drum turns smoothly and efficiently. If they're damaged and cause loud squeaking or even grinding sounds. A new method for studying the acoustic characteristics of household appliances has been developed. This technique combines sound intensity measurements and vibration measurements. This allows the acoustic efficiency of washing machines to be evaluated accurately. This can help manufacturers improve the quality of their products by reducing the amount of noise they generate.

The experiment was carried out using a front-loading washer with a 9 kg laundry capacity. The experiment included an aluminum tub suspended from the base of the machine by springs, and three shock absorbers with free-stroke friction. The cabinet's vibration and the drum's movement were recorded and their acoustic emissions were measured. These recordings were used to calculate the acoustic strength of each transmission path. The results revealed that the non-resonant transmission path had the highest impact on the frequencies with the highest frequency. The effect diminished with increasing frequency. The radiation path, on the other hand, influenced all frequencies and was most prominent at the 125 Hz frequency.

Energy

The energy efficiency of washing machines is measured by the amount of water and electricity it consumes in a single cycle. This can be improved or decreased based on the size of the washing load and the energy-saving features that are selected. Eco modes, for instance, allow smaller loads to wash with less energy and water. Other energy-saving features are delayed start, stain removal setting and variable spinning speeds.

In general, machines with larger capacities use more energy. However when the washer is equipped with energy-saving features, its overall energy consumption will be less than a model similar in size but with no energy-saving features.

A washing machine's rated capacity is measured in kilograms (kg) of cotton. This is the maximum amount dry laundry that a machine can efficiently wash in one cycle. The greater the capacity rating the more laundry can be washed in a single cycle. In the last decade, many new washing machines with ever-growing capacities have been introduced on the European market. At the same time, European household sizes have been shrinking. This imbalance is threatening the achievement of the energy efficiency targets of the policy goals for these appliances.
